Updated Printing Notifications
During Winter Break the IT Department implemented several new software policies in regards to printing. Due to this, it is suggested that you restart your computer if it was left up and running during break.

Now, when you print to the Color Follow Me queues, you will be asked if you are sure if you want to print in color. If you print more than four pages to the Black and White Follow Me queue, and are set to print single sided, you will be asked if you want to change it to duplex (double sided).

If you have problems with printing to the color printers, please submit a support request, and the IT Department will get the issue resolved as soon as possible.
